Output e2c5278763dcbccac2cc63a66ed733579b84bb49f1a884c07aafa6c3c4561f16:15

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ced40e55ccfb19f5837e7e83d88d2e35630447cc OP_EQUAL
address
ABHstpGURaF4NqiDwZymML56oXiH9wZX8S
transaction
e2c5278763dcbccac2cc63a66ed733579b84bb49f1a884c07aafa6c3c4561f16